MapsTaman Selayang Indah in Seberang Perai Utara, Penang recorded 6 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M1.60 million and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M499.
This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.
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M1.60 million,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M1.49 million to RM1.71 million, and a typical market range of RM1.51 million to RM1.69 million.
Most transactions involved detached, with moderate diversity in property types available.
For price per square foot, the median is RM499, with most transactions between RM471 and RM527. The usual range is RM476.81 to RM520.81, showing that most units are priced quite close to each other. A typical spread (IQR) of RM44.00 and an average deviation (MAD) of RM28 indicate a highly stable PSF trend across properties.
